RH1288 V3ipmcset 命令唤醒屏幕

问题描述

OS版本:Debian 8.0.0  命令行版本,没有图形化界面。 iBMC版本:3.04

BMC 命令行里执行 ipmcset -d printscreen [-v wakeup] ,唤醒屏幕并且截屏,但是客户现场执行命令后还是无法唤醒屏幕,截屏都是黑屏。

解决方案

1、等待OS进入休眠状态:

2、执行ipmcset –d printscreen –v wakeup命令成功:


3、查看截屏的manualscreen.jpeg,为黑屏,现象与客户现场一致:


4、进入KVM,移动鼠标、点击鼠标左/中/右键,滚动中键,均不能唤醒OS,(从原理上分析,printscreen命令和KVM唤醒OS都是发送的鼠标消息,理应都能唤醒或都不能唤醒才对):
5、KVM里敲键盘,能唤醒OS,此时执行ipmcset –d printscreen命令成功:
6、查看本次截屏的manualscreen.jpeg,为唤醒后的屏幕:

7、查看BMC实现的ipmcset –d printscreen –v wakeup命令是通过移动鼠标唤醒屏幕的,所以对Debian 8这种需要敲键盘才能唤醒的OS不生效。

这个是由于不同OS唤醒方式不一样导致的,而BMC的实现难以覆盖到所有的OS唤醒方式。

上一篇 思科路由器控制列表ACL增删
下一篇 iSitePower产品ICC50型号iSitePower_V100R022C00SPC110 版本无电无网场景下光伏电池耗光无法自启动故障